## Firmware Channel Promotion — Plugin Authors

Before publishing to the Veltrix stable channel, confirm your plugin passes the Harkline conformance suite against firmware 4.2 and 4.3. Promotions from beta to stable are gated by a 48-hour soak on at least fifty devices. Never skip the rollback manifest step; devices stuck mid-flash cannot recover without it. The full channel promotion checklist, including soak thresholds, is maintained on the page below.

dashboard of kahap-yajof = https://superset.qirvanforge.internal/ticket/deploy/secrets/view/repo/projects/browse/b82fa9fa5da23b3020149682

Ticket: Staging env misconfigured for Siftgate bloom filter

The bloom layer in front of the Pellet KV store is rejecting all lookups in staging because the env file was copied from the dev template without credentials. False-positive tuning values are fine; only the auth line is missing. To unblock the weekly demo, the Pellet admission secret must be set on the following line.

env line for yaguf-fajop: LEDGER_TOKEN13=fb08984397349

For this week's sync: Textwell sniffs uploaded text files in two passes. First, a BOM check; if absent, we run statistical detection over the first 64 KB. Files that score below the confidence threshold fall back to the tenant's declared default encoding rather than guessing. Misdetections usually trace back to short files or mixed-encoding exports from legacy systems. If you're triaging a garbled-upload report, confirm the detector's thresholds first. The detection service currently runs with the configuration values below.

settings of fafog-haduf:
ZORIX_PIN=4648
ZORIX_METRICS_HOST=metrics.zorix.paliqsys.corp
ZORIX_LOG_LEVEL=info
ZORIX_TENANT=druix

## Escalation — dependency pinning

All services in the Corvid platform pin direct dependencies to exact versions; transitive ranges are resolved by the lockfile committed with each release. If a security advisory requires an unpinned upgrade, open an exception ticket and tag the build-infra rotation; do not edit lockfiles by hand on release branches. Exceptions expire after 30 days and must be re-reviewed. If the rotation does not respond within one business day, escalate directly to the platform stewardship inbox.

escalation mailbox, bafog-fafog: ulador@paliqlabs.internal